Abstract
Link analysis is the most important application of web structure mining and serves as a source of new knowledge in web information retrieval. Designing an effective link structure for customer interfaces is critical for the success of cybermalls. The user interface of a cybermall should provide friendly and pleasant shopping environments. A smart link structure that supports convenient moves and jumps serves to this end. We suggest the use of a customer tracking vector using the flow movement of customer interface. The main contribution of this paper is our unique approach to classify hypertext pages based on flow movement and extend the application of flow data for the design and structure of hypertext pages (nodes). This methodology help to create new links to obtain an efficient path to the right destination for customers when there are too many paths to choose from.
